A new addition to Kingsway and Fraser area has opened, Che Baba Cantina is a nice little neighborhood spot.
If you’re looking for yoga, they offer that too, right next door.
Their menu is French and Mediterranean inspired, it’s simple, and the space is small and inviting.
They serve brunch on the weekend (which is on my list), but I was there for dinner with friends.
We enjoyed the Poached Pear and Endive salad, which was a decent size (I hate too large or small salads); there was also the special Tomato and Boccocini salad, which is always a favourite. I found the food fresh, tasty and not badly priced.
For entrée’s we all enjoyed: Wild Mushroom and Truffle Risotto – very tasty; The fish special which changes; and the pasta special which also changes. All very good. I think as they change up the menu and try some new things, it can only get better!
The Wine menu was decent, with beers as well. But I think the dessert topped off the evening! A Poached Pear with Chocolate – is the perfect finale to any meal.
Worth a visit & now two good little eateries in that block! It could even become a local favourite.
